There is no way to recover this thing. A chargeback is last resort for this and here i am not sure a chargeback can be raised by Airtel, as chargeback is generally raised for a disputed transaction done for a service done by merchant (here it is money transfer and not a merchant service).

Though in this case as well, chargeback can be raised by marking the transaction disputed, but i highly doubt Airtel will do that.

Happened once with me,
Transferred 5k from payzapp to wrong icici account
Since i had an account with icici, went to branch, and explained them, they were kind enough to share the details of person with me.
I followed up, the person was ready to refund, however his account had become dormant, since he hadnt used it for long.
He activated his account and instantly icici guys deducted entire 5k in multiples of 300 as non maintenance of minimum balance charges

There is a way you can get back your money. Please read through my story.

We all make mistakes in our life. Isn’t it ? However, while it’s having financial impact, then it hurts a lot. Let me describe one of such mistake which has direct financial impact on us.
Now a days UPI is a very common mode of transaction to transfer money from one account to another account. Every bank asks its customer to set an UPI id (like account number and unique) and using the same you can transfer money from one account to another account who is holding another UPI ID on real time. However, what happens, in case by mistake you put a wrong recipient ID and transfer the money and you don’t know the recipient🤦🏻‍♂🙈

For e.g you intend to send money to abc123@dbs account and by mistake you send it to abc1234@dbs and a recipient exists with UPI id abc1234@dbs

Is there any way that you can get back your money? I will discuss it today from my real life experience.

Last month while travelling, from my mobile banking I was wrongly sent Rs.65000/- to xyz@dbs instead of xyz123@dbs and unfortunately, xyz@dbs and xyz123@dbs has the same name, and money transferred immediately to wrong recipient (xyz@dbs).

First few minutes I was totally clueless what to do, however, first made my call to HDFC (from where I have transferred the money) and their call center executive told me directly that there is no way to get back it. After getting such an disappointing answer, I search on Google and didn’t get any proper way what to do. Some of the suggestions were like that re-send Re.1 and request the wrong recipient to return it. I did it, however no answer. I was really clueless what to do next?
Being in banking profession for last 3 years, I know that you can request the recipient bank to put a lien on the amount with proper proof.

So, next I called DBS customer care executive, and provide all details related to that wrong transaction and they confirmed that the money has been credited to wrong recipient x...bs. On my request the customer care executive put lien on the Rs. 65000/- amount which I sent incorrectly and requested me to raise a Chargeback with my bank. i.e HDFC.
To explain the Lien, it’s a legal right of the owner to hold on the amount until the charges get clear. In simple word the recipient will not able to withdraw the money until the dispute gets cleared.

The next step was to request my bank (HDFC) to raise a Chargeback against it. Chargeback is the process through which your bank requests to recipient’s bank to refund the amount.

The TAT for chargeback is 35 days, so the next 35 days you have to idle, and most irritating part you will get only one answer from bank executive that the TAT is 35 days so please wait, we can’t able to provide any information apart from this.

Once the chargeback is processed successfully, the recipient bank (DBS in my case) will contact the recipient and asked for Debit concern of the amount and once the recipient provides the same, the money will be refunded to your bank account and it will be credited to your account.

However, there are lot of challenges.

1) if the mobile number of the recipient is not updated, what to do? The answer is you can’t do anything and without a debit concern from the recipient, the bank can’t able to debit the amount. In my case the recipient was not contactable, however, bank (DBS) tried to find out other contact details of the customer and fortunately they were able to contact in another number and got debit concern.

In case the customer is not at all contactable, then bank will reject your Chargeback request, giving the same reason, and your chargeback request will be rejected . Once it gets rejected, you have to write a mail (to the following mail ids) to RBI Ombudsman and there is a panel under RBI Ombudsman who looks after Digital Transaction Disputes. After your request, they will check it and if they find that your claim is true, and the recipient is not at all contactable, then RBI Ombudsman will take measure accordingly and there is high possibilities that you will get your money back. However, it will take considerable time.

2) If the recipient deny to provide a Debit concern on the amount (highly unlikely) by claiming it’s his money, then also your chargeback request will be rejected. In this case you have to first lodge an FIR against the recipient for fraud case and then contact a Lawyer with all your proof. And the process will be handled lawfully then which involves money and time.
However, these are two process you have to follow when such incident happens. But it’s always preferable to check recipient’s UPI id 10 times before you process any transaction or better to use NEFT or IMPS to send money. Atleast it’s much safer bet than UPI ID.

However, at the end of the day we are human beings and make mistakes. Hope my experience and explanation atleast will help how to go ahead in case you do such kind of mistake in future.
Our banking system is well designed and there is resolution of every mistakes. However, the problem is that most of us are unaware about the process and same you will not able to know from banking personnel (as the HDFC customer and my dedicated HDFC RM told me that there is no process to get back your money once you transfer money using UPI ID).

Always write mails or Tweet banking care services, which is much faster rather calling customer care executives and always documented everything.

In banking system, first write mail (I am providing example of HDFC) to Supports ([email protected]), if you don’t get correct or satisfied or timely reply, write to grievance cell ([email protected]). In case you don’t get satisfactory timely response, write to Nodal Officer ([email protected]). Please check correct mail id from net as per your bank and region.

If all fails, write to RBI ombudsman. I am sure you will get correct resolution.
